Good Evening All

Just on with a bathroom in silver trav at the moment that requires quite a bit of bullnosing/polishing.

I have used the same formula as I would with mid trav - stone router then 80, 220, 400 Silicon carbide paper but with this stone i'm having difficulty matching the finished appearance with the face of the stone.

The bullnosed area looks faded and flat and you can see a clear contrast between the 2 surfaces.

When wet the 2 look equal.

Any thoughts? Do Lithofin does a enhancer that does not give a wet/gloss look?

We have the lithofin colour intensifier which could be tested, cloth a small amount to the edge. This is an impregnator with a Matt finish. or could you come Up a further grade on the paper which may bring colour through or will that produce a greater shine than the tile body,
 
400# silicon carbide is a honed/satin finish, you'll need to go further with 600, 800 and maybe even 1200 to bring up the polish to the same degree.

Chemicals won't help, it's a mechanical polish you require.

Also be very sure to spend long enough getting the tool marks of the profiler out, they will show more as the polish is increased.
 
Apologies it is honed.

400 on slow speed is the highest grade I can go otherwise it starts to polish, yet it looks as though it needs a high grade to bring the colour through.


Have tried Lithofin Colour Intensifier on the edge and it seems to have worked a treat and blends the face and edge in well.
